Frequently Asked Questions

Is Georgetown, TX or Rapid City, SD safer?

Georgetown is safer with a higher safety score by 19 points. Georgetown, TX has a safety score of 76/100 while Rapid City, SD has 57/100, based on FBI Uniform Crime Report data.

What is the violent crime rate in Georgetown, TX vs Rapid City, SD?

Georgetown, TX has a violent crime rate of 191.1 per 100,000 residents, while Rapid City, SD has 718.9 per 100,000. Lower rates indicate safer communities. The national average is approximately 380 per 100,000.

What is the property crime rate in Georgetown, TX vs Rapid City, SD?

Georgetown, TX has a property crime rate of 1170.1 per 100,000, compared to 3792.1 per 100,000 in Rapid City, SD. Property crimes include burglary, theft, and motor vehicle theft.

How are CrimeSafe safety scores calculated?

Safety scores range from 0-100, combining violent crime rates, property crime rates, and population data from the FBI UCR. Higher scores mean safer cities. Grades: A (80+), B (65-79), C (50-64), D (40-49), F (below 40).
